TZM alloys and TIG welding
TIG welding is called tungsten inert gas shielded welding. It is a welding method that usually uses tungsten electrode as the electrode material and argon gas as the protective gas. In TIG welding, manufacturers usually use thoriated tungsten electrodes, cerium tungsten electrodes and zirconium tungsten electrodes as electrode materials.
According to the type of power source, TIG welding can be divided into three types: DC TIG welding, AC TIG welding and pulse TIG welding. According to the operating method, TIG welding can be divided into: manual welding, automatic welding, and semi-automatic welding, among which GTAW is the most widely used.
Using TIG welding to weld TZM alloy can effectively prevent the intrusion of oxygen and nitrogen during the welding process. The study found that the optimal process parameters for TIG welding of TZM alloy are: welding current: 210A, arc voltage 25V, welding speed: 4mm/s, argon gas flow: 8~12L/min. Analysis of the microstructure of the TZM alloy welded joint found that the grains in the welding area were coarse and contained a small number of black spots, but the weld structure was dense and there were certain cracks.
In addition, the coarse-grained zone and transition zone are affected by thermal effects, which essentially eliminates the plate-like grain structure of the alloy, and recrystallizes into coarse equiaxed grains, while the original base material still maintains the lamellar crystal and braided structure. The elimination of the plate-like grain structure weakens the strength of TZM alloys.
TZM alloy (molybdenum zirconium-titanium alloy) and physical properties of pure molybdenum compared as follows:
Material | density /g·cm-3 | Melting point /℃ | Boiling point /℃ |
TZM alloy (Ti0.5/Zr0.1) | 10.22 | 2617 | 4612 |
Mo | 10.29 | 2610 | 5560 |
Mechanical Properties of TZM alloy (molybdenum zirconium-titanium alloy) (ri0.5 / Zr0.1) as follows:
Mechanical Properties | Elongation (%) | elasticity modulus GPa | Tensile strength Mpa | yield strength Mpa | fracture toughness MP·m1/2) |
Value | <20 | 320 | 685 | 560-1150 | 5.8-29.6 |
TZM alloy (molybdenum zirconium-titanium alloy) high-temperature tensile strength and elongation:
Temperature | tensile strength(Mpa) | Elongation |
RT | 1140-1210 | 7.5-13.0 |
1000 | 700-720 | 5.2 |
1200 | 320-360 | 9.0 |
1300 | 190-210 | 11.5-13.5 |
1400 | 140-170 | 11-16 |
TZM alloy (molybdenum zirconium-titanium alloy) thermal performance and electrical properties:
Performance | coefficient of thermal expansion /K-1(20~100℃) | thermal conductivity W/m·K | Using maximum temperature in air ℃ | ResistivityΩ·m |
Value | 5.3X10-6 | 126 | 400 | (5.3~5.5)X10-8 |
